BOTTLE AND CAN REFUNDS
This could be a great way to earn the club extra funds.
I found this on the web when I saw the 10c sign on a stubby of beer and
looked it up
How to get involved From 1 December, schools, charities and community groups can fundraise through Return and
Earn, simply by collecting eligible containers and redeeming them at collection points for 10
cents each (collection points will be announced on this site soon).
Opportunities will continue to grow, and we’ll be able to offer further support, as Return and
Earn continues to roll out across NSW. Options will include collecting containers (and asking
community members to donate their containers to your organisation), becoming a collection
point, or having your charity listed on reverse vending machines (where the public can choose to
directly donate their refunds to you).

THE FOUR WAY TEST Of the things we think, say or do:
Is it the TRUTH? Is it FAIR to all concerned?
Will it build GOODWILL and better FRIENDSHIPS? Will it be BENEFICIAL to all concerned?
